Analysis

Liberia recorded 3.6% for population ages 65 and above, female in 2025. That is the highest value across all 66 years on record.

Compared with earlier readings it is up 1.1% on the previous year and up 7.4% over ten years.

Over the whole period, population ages 65 and above, female in Liberia peaked at 3.6% in 2025 and was at its lowest, 2.6%, in 1975.

That places Liberia 190th out of 218 countries with data for 2025, putting it in the bottom quarter.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 66 years of available data.

Female population 65 years of age or older as a percentage of the total female population. Population is based on the de facto definition of population, which counts all residents regardless of legal status or citizenship.
